State Police are investigating a crash that injured a man at US Route 20 near Antwerp Ave in Egg Harbor City, NJ on November 22nd, 2021. Police say the incident happened when a commercial truck collided with a car under unclear circumstances around 7:30 a.m. After that collision, the truck continued through oncoming traffic through a field before striking a tree and crashing into a home. An 80-year-old resident of the home suffered non-life-threatening injuries when the impact caused him to fall through an upper floor into a basement. The driver of the truck was also hospitalized with non-life-threatening injuries. Additional information was not immediately available.
